It is generally okay to gather or assemble when it is safe and lawful to do so, ensuring compliance with local regulations and public health guidelines. For instance, social gatherings can occur during celebrations, community events, or meetings, provided they do not pose a risk to participants or the wider community. It is also important to respect the rights of others and prioritize safety, especially during times of crisis or conflict. Always consider the context and purpose of the assembly to ensure it is appropriate.
